In a 10-year examine of 290 people who had been hospitalized with BPD, greater than 90 p.c had passed a two-year milestone without signs, and 86 % have been symptom-free for a minimum of 4 years. Half achieved what the examine outlined as full recovery—they not only had no signs, they'd at least one close relationship and have been working or going to highschool full-time. Sixteen years after being hospitalized for BPD, seventy nine percent of recovered subjects had gotten married or lived with a partner for greater than five years.
